Restructurings & Charges

Seagate Technology Holdings plc announced a restructuring with charges of approximately $150 million.

“The Plan, which the Company expects to be substantially completed by the end of the fiscal fourth quarter 2023, is expected to result in total pre-tax charges of approximately $150 million. The charges are expected to be primarily cash-based and consist of employee severance and other one-time termination benefits. The Company expects to realize run-rate savings of”

Material Agreements

Seagate Technology Holdings plc entered into Settlement Agreement with U.S. Department of Commerce’s Bureau of Industry and Security (BIS) valued at $300 million (effective 2023-04-18).

“On April 18, 2023, Seagate Technology LLC and Seagate Singapore International Headquarters Pte. Ltd (collectively, “Seagate”), each a subsidiary of Seagate Technology Holdings public limited company (the “Company”), entered into a settlement agreement (the “Settlement Agreement”) with the U.S. Department of Commerce’s Bureau of Industry and Security (“BIS”) that resolves BIS’s allegations regarding Seagate’s sales of hard disk drives to Huawei between August 17, 2020 and September 29, 2021.”

Debt Financings

Seagate Technology Holdings plc incurred senior notes of $750 million with Computershare Trust Company, National Association at 9.625% maturing December 1, 2032.

“On November 30, 2022, Seagate HDD Cayman (“Seagate HDD”), an exempted company with limited liability organized under the laws of the Cayman Islands and an indirect subsidiary of Seagate Technology Holdings plc (the “Company”), issued approximately $750 million in aggregate principal amount of 9.625% Senior Notes due 2032 (the “New Notes”) in connection with Seagate HDD’s exchange offers to certain eligible holders of Seagate HDD’s outstanding 3.125% Senior Notes due 2029, 4.091% Senior Notes due 2029, 3.375% Senior Notes due 2031, and 4.125% Senior Notes due 2031 (the “Exchange Offers”).”
